Top Maps & Navigation Apps in Greece: Q1 2025 Performance

In the first quarter of 2025, the top Maps and Navigation apps in Greece demonstrated varied performance metrics across downloads, revenue, and active users on a unified platform. Here's a detailed look at their performance:

Navionics® Boating from Garmin showed a consistent growth in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$4.6K by the end of March. Downloads fluctuated slightly, with a peak of 261 in late January, while active users remained stable around 375 by the quarter's end.

Circuit Route Planner experienced a peak in weekly revenue at $1.5K in early February. Downloads varied, reaching a high of 282 in late January. Active users saw a notable increase, ending the quarter with 616 users.

Wikiloc - Trails of the World had a surge in downloads in February, reaching up to 4.7K. Revenue peaked at $1.9K mid-January, whereas active users saw a significant rise to 5.9K in mid-February.

Sygic GPS Navigation & Maps maintained a steady revenue, peaking at $855 in late February. Downloads saw a spike in mid-February with 1.6K, while active users peaked at 2.7K in the same period.

TomTom GO Navigation experienced a revenue high of $705 in early March. Downloads were notably high at 506 in late March, with active users also increasing to 573 by the end of the quarter.

These insights, derived from Sensor Tower data, showcase the dynamic landscape of Maps and Navigation apps in Greece, offering further details and trends for deeper analysis.
